Commercial Demolition Service in Houston, TX
Commercial demolition services involve the safe and efficient removal of entire structures or specific parts of buildings in commercial properties. These projects typically include the demolition of office buildings, retail spaces, warehouses, or industrial facilities. Property owners usually seek this service when preparing a site for new construction, remodeling, or renovation projects. Before requesting commercial demolition, it’s important to understand the scope of work, the potential impact on neighboring properties, and any necessary permits or regulations that may apply in the Houston area.
Property owners should also consider the extent of the demolition needed, whether it involves complete removal or selective dismantling of certain sections. Clarifying the timeline, site accessibility, and disposal of debris are essential steps in planning a successful project. Understanding these details helps ensure that the demolition process aligns with the overall development plans and complies with local codes and safety standards.

Common Commercial Demolition Service Jobs
Commercial Building Demolition - removal of entire structures to prepare sites for new development.
Interior Demolition - stripping out interior spaces for renovations or repurposing.
Selective Demolition - carefully dismantling specific areas or elements within a building.
Industrial Demolition - dismantling large-scale facilities like factories or warehouses.
Concrete and Masonry Demolition - breaking down driveways, walls, or foundations for site clearing.
Structural Demolition - safely taking down load-bearing elements to facilitate construction projects.
Commercial Demolition Service Questions
What types of structures are suitable for commercial demolition? Commercial demolition services can handle a variety of structures, including warehouses, retail stores, office buildings, and industrial facilities.
Is site preparation necessary before demolition? Yes, site preparation involves clearing the area, disconnecting utilities, and ensuring safety measures are in place prior to demolition.
What should property owners consider before starting a demolition project? It's important to review permits, assess the structure's condition, and plan for debris removal and site cleanup.
What are common reasons for requesting commercial demolition services? Common reasons include building obsolescence, property redevelopment, structural issues, or code compliance requirements.
